MSN Search Beta To Be More Exposed To The Public
The MSN Search Beta opened to the public some time ago, but only those actively seeking it out really got
to try it. MSN has routed a small number of those using the regular MSN Search site to the beta since its launch in November. Now, even
more people will be routed over beginning next week, the service has said via its blog: Beta Ramp-Up.
No official date for when the service will go live has been updated, but the ramp up suggests that it won’t be long now.
